GPT-OSS 120B is the 3rd ranked open model by Artificial Analysis's Index, behind Qwen3 235B 2507 and DeepSeek R1 0528.

But that's only half the story: GPT-OSS 120B is 4 times as fast as Qwen3 and 10 times faster than DeepSeek.

And look at the 20B model, all alone!
